Rendzina - Academic Dictionaries and Encyclopedias
rendzina — noun Etymology: Polish rędzina rich limy soil Date: 1922 any of a group of dark grayish brown intrazonal soils developed in grassy regions of high to moderate humidity from soft calcareous marl or chalk …. New Collegiate Dictionary. rendzina — ren·dzi·na (rĕn jēʹnə) n. A dark soil that develops under grass on limestone ...
